An educational psychological assessment consists of different activities that can help in identifying a child’s particular learning style, areas of need, and strengths. In addition, this type of assessment helps in coming up with appropriate recommendations for the parents, teachers, and other professionals that work on meeting the educational needs of kids and teenagers.

The one-on-one educational assessments setting offers an opportunity to collect information about a child’s behavior , attention, attitudes, concentration levels, etc., which impact and influence a child’s learning . These factors can also affect the motivation to accept and approach any challenge. It also affects how a child/ teenager comes any task as well as the way they structure their responses.

The Learning Profile 

The learning profile, generated by the assessment, conveys a lot of information about the child/ teenager, both education and behaviour-wise. In addition, the assessment generates scores which are known as IQ scores. These can be considered as estimates of cognitive ability, which helps in understanding and predicting how a child will perform in an academic field.

The observations of the assessments can also increase the understanding of how a child will approach any task or reach to praise and failures, as well as their generic attitude towards learning. Understanding the results of cognitive assessment and implementing the recommendations can help the teachers, parents, and other people involved in academics to understand a child’s cognitive profile.

The IQ Assessment Can Be Used For:

  • Gaining a comprehensive understanding of a child’s weaknesses and strengths so that they can be worked on.
  • Determining if the child can reach the learning potential.
  • Evaluate the fluctuations in attention as well as concentration levels.
  • Diagnosis of particular learning issues along with suitable assessments.

Cognitive assessment measures various fields such as verbal and non-verbal ability, processing speeds, working memory, and more. The scores of each of these areas will reflect the ability of the child in different areas measured.

What Kind Of Assessment Tools Are Used?

The main assessment is to determine the intellectual strengths and needs. Just getting the generic IQ score won’t help. The details of particular areas of needs and strengths reveal helpful information. Along with cognitive ability, the assessment consists of measures of academic achievement and other specific tests which might be necessary.

The decision of what tests are required depends on the challenges identified and observations made during the test. Understanding the language, reading and writing skills, and language comprehension is also evaluated.

Remember that interpretation of the results won’t solely be based on the difference in test scores. They will be integrated will relevant professional bodies which are involved. Analysis of the scores will help get an idea of the child’s strengths and needs.

It can also help in planning the learning activities, which can build particular strengths to overcome the learning issues. It helps in developing confidence as well as competence. Apart from the detailed results, a summary of key recommendations will also be offered.

How Long Does Assessment Take?

The assessment can take almost 3 to 3.5 hours, and the time taken by each child will depend on their attention ability, motivation , and more. Once the assessment is done, other assessments may be recommended for evaluating possible concerns.

What Happens After The Assessment Results?

Once the child’s skillset is assessed, interventions may be recommended. The idea behind these recommendations is to improve the difficulties that are found with the evaluation.

Another aim of the educational assessment report is to understand of the challenges they are facing. The report also gives suggestions which can be implemented at home and school.

If the child is taking consultation from professionals such as speech therapists, occupational therapists, etc., it can guide the therapy interventions.
